When your refrigerator stops cooling properly, food safety becomes a concern. We diagnose compressor issues, temperature control problems, defrost system malfunctions, and sealed system concerns that affect refrigerator performance.

Do not open electrical panels, gas components, sealed systems, or internal wiring unless qualified to do so. Working on appliances without proper training can result in electric shock, gas hazards, or voided warranties. When in doubt, contact a qualified appliance repair professional.

Appliance symptoms can have multiple causes. A dishwasher that won't drain might have a clogged filter, a failed pump, a blocked drain line, or a control issue. A refrigerator that's warm could be dealing with a defrost problem, a sealed-system concern, or a simple thermostat failure.
Random part replacement can waste money. Replacing a component without confirming it's actually failed means spending money on parts that may not address the issue—and potentially still needing additional service afterward. Systematic troubleshooting identifies the real problem first.
Correct diagnosis helps identify the actual problem and gives homeowners the information they need to make good decisions. When you understand what's wrong and why, you can weigh repair against replacement with confidence.
Some appliance repairs involve electrical, water, heating, or mechanical systems. Professional evaluation is safer for complex problems and helps ensure the repair is done correctly the first time.
